The holiday most-associated with love and passion certainly didn't have such romantic beginnings. Saint Valentine's life was plagued with Christian martyrdom, persecution, execution, and, well, you get the point. It wasn't until Geoffrey Chaucer penned "Parlement of Foules" in 1382 that the holiday took a more tender turn. The poem, which Chaucer wrote to celebrate King Richard II and his betrothed, spoke of Valentine's Day (or, as Chaucer called it, Volantynys day) and birds mating (dreamy, huh?).

Centuries later, the holiday is big business. According to the Valentine's Day Consumer Intentions and Actions Survey commissioned by the National Retail Federation, U.S. consumers are expected to spend 18.6 billion on the holiday this year. It's no wonder that many poo poo Valentine's Day as nothing more than a Hallmark-created holiday.
